Delaware pediatrician Earl Bradley faces charges in the sexual abuse of  more than 100 young children over a period of  ten years. Despite several complaints over the years, the system failed to protect his victims. We talk with LINDA AMMONS, associate provost and dean of the Widener University School of Law who conducted an independent review of the case, and LISA COHEN a psychologist whose research focuses on pedophiles.
